Zauba

UFS SUPPLY CHAIN SOLUTIONS INDIA PRIVATE LIMITEDCIN: U52240HR2025PTC133304
new.inc
UFS SUPPLY CHAIN SOLUTIONS INDIA PRIVATE LIMITED | Zauba